  3. I'm very new to modding(3 days), so i might ask some dopey questions. My code looks like this: if (entityName.equals(playerName)) { KeyBinding.onTick(minecraft.gameSettings.keyBindJump.getKey()); KeyBinding.onTick(minecraft.gameSettings.keyBindDrop.getKey()); } When the player got hurt, the player jump and drop the item in hand. The drop works properly, but the jump doesn't want to activate. if I do the to string: System.out.println(minecraft.gameSettings.keyBindDrop.toString()); System.out.println(minecraft.gameSettings.keyBindJump.getKey().toString()); the console seems right to me net.minecraft.client.settings.KeyBinding@4a4ef86a key.keyboard.space Minecraft version 1.15.2 Forge version: forge-1.15.2-31.2.0-mdk
